OIDC for Cross-Platform Authentication

Date Created: 27 Nov 2023
Share:   
In the digital age, where users interact with multiple platforms and services, ensuring a smooth and secure authentication experience across various applications poses a significant challenge for organizations.

OIDC for Cross-Platform Authentication

In the digital age, where users interact with multiple platforms and services, ensuring a smooth and secure authentication experience across various applications poses a significant challenge for organizations. OpenID Connect (OIDC) has emerged as a powerful solution for achieving seamless user authentication across diverse platforms. This blog explores the relevance, benefits, implementation, and impact of OIDC in enabling frictionless cross-platform authentication for users.

The Challenge of Cross-Platform Authentication

As web and mobile applications multiply, users frequently encounter various platforms, each with its distinct authentication method. This diversity results in a fragmented user experience, demanding users to manage multiple credentials and engage in separate login procedures, leading to inconvenience and raising security apprehensions.

Enter OpenID Connect (OIDC)

OpenID Connect, developed atop the OAuth 2.0 framework, serves as an identity layer providing a secure and standardized approach to user authentication and authorization. This technology facilitates Single Sign-On (SSO), enabling users to access multiple applications using a sole set of credentials, thereby streamlining the authentication process.

Key Aspects and Benefits of OIDC:

Authentication Protocol: OIDC defines a protocol for authentication, allowing users to authenticate themselves and obtain information about their identity.

Simplicity and Interoperability: Its simplicity and compatibility with OAuth 2.0 facilitate easy integration across a wide range of platforms, ensuring interoperability and seamless implementation.

Single Sign-On (SSO): OIDC enables SSO functionality, providing users with a unified login experience across various applications and services without the need for multiple credentials.

Enhanced Security: With robust security measures, including token-based authentication and encrypted communication, OIDC ensures the protection of user identities and sensitive information.

Implementing OIDC for Cross-Platform Authentication

1. OIDC Endpoints Setup:

Issuer URL: Configure the URL where identity tokens are issued.

Authorization Endpoint: Define the URL where users authenticate and authorize access to their information.

Token Endpoint: Set up the URL for acquiring tokens used in authentication.

2. Integration with Applications:

Client Registration: Register applications with the OIDC provider to obtain client IDs and secrets required for authentication.

Authentication Flow: Implement OIDCs authentication flow within applications, enabling users to log in using their OIDC credentials.

3. User Experience Enhancement:

Unified Login Experience: Users experience a seamless login process across various platforms, improving convenience and reducing friction.

4. Security Measures:

Token-based Security: Utilize tokens for authentication, ensuring secure access to user data while preventing unauthorized access.

5. Continuous Monitoring and Maintenance:

Regular Audits: Conduct routine checks and audits to maintain security and functionality.

Updates and Patches: Implement timely updates and patches to address any vulnerabilities or performance issues.

OIDC in Practice: Transforming User Authentication

1. Enterprise Applications:

OIDC enables streamlined authentication across numerous enterprise applications, enhancing user productivity and security.

2. Mobile Applications:

Mobile app developers leverage OIDC to provide users with a cohesive authentication experience across Android and iOS platforms.

3. Web Services:

Websites and web services integrate OIDC to offer users a consistent and hassle-free login process across browsers and devices.

Future Outlook: OIDCs Role in Authentication

As the digital ecosystem continues to evolve, OIDCs role in enabling seamless cross-platform authentication is poised for further growth. Its standardized approach, simplified integration, and user-centric authentication experience position it as a key solution for addressing authentication challenges in an increasingly interconnected digital world.

OIDC Services by Cripsa for B2B SaaS Companies

Cripsa stands as a notable provider offering OIDC services that cater specifically to authentication needs. Leveraging Cripsas OIDC solutions, enterprises can seamlessly integrate OpenID Connect within their systems, ensuring robust and standardized authentication methods.

Key Highlights of Cripsas OIDC Services:

Enterprise-grade Authentication: Cripsas OIDC services are tailored for B2B SaaS enterprises, focusing on delivering enterprise-grade authentication solutions to enhance security and user experience.

Custom Integration: Cripsa offers customized integration support, allowing seamless implementation of OIDC across diverse platforms and applications used within enterprise environments.

Scalability and Reliability: Cripsas OIDC solutions are designed for scalability, ensuring consistent performance and reliability even in high-demand enterprise environments.

Security Compliance: Cripsas OIDC services prioritize security compliance, ensuring adherence to industry standards and protocols, thereby fortifying the authentication framework against potential vulnerabilities.

Embracing Seamless Authentication with OIDC

OpenID Connect serves as a pivotal solution in simplifying and unifying the authentication experience for users across diverse platforms. Its ability to facilitate Single Sign-On, ensure security, and enhance user experience underscores its significance in modern-day authentication practices.

By implementing OIDC, organizations can streamline their authentication processes, provide users with a consistent login experience, and fortify security measures, thus delivering enhanced user satisfaction and security in todays interconnected digital landscape.

With Cripsas OIDC services, B2B SaaS companies can confidently implement OIDC-based authentication solutions tailored for enterprise-level requirements. This enables them to deliver enhanced authentication experiences while ensuring robust security measures across their services, promoting trust and reliability among their enterprise clientele.